muscle size increases by doing two things
1. giving the muscle stimulaton through,preferably, heavier weights
2. giving the ody the right amount and correct nutrients that it needs to help recover
your bicep workout doesnt seem bad its something i would even do and maybe switch it around with concentration /preacher/hammer curls just for variety.
use a handful of mass exercises and train them heavy and hard and then once you've "milked" them dry, swap it to something unfamiliar.
i have tried teaming up arms with other bodyparts but for me itdoesnt work i prefer towork arms alone at the end of the week after my upper body workouts hvae been completed.

Quote:
Originally Posted by beach body boy
i got another question ,, some people told me to make my workout 4 example bench + bi then shoulders + tri ,, 4 me i don't work 2 muscles i prefere to work only one muscle like bench only or sholder only or "bi+tri" only, but my question which is better for da arm muscle to work it with bench + sholders or work the arm alone bi+tri ,or make a day 4 bi only and a day 4 tri only ????????
it depends, whatever works for you. i work my bi's on chest day and my tri's on shoulder day. I tried dedicating each day of the week to a certain body part, but it just didnt work out the way i wanted. it just didnt allow my body enough time to recover. working bi's and tri's on the same day can work. i tried it and i noticed when doing chest day my arms got fatigued rather quickly. but try them all and see what works.
